Luc Tuymans shows three early drawings – in which the artist plays with proportions and enlargements – combined with the almost epic portrait The Sleeper, next to a portrait of Anthony Van Dijck. While the dark tone of his work is offset by vividly brushed brush strokes – referring to Velasquez and Goya – the artist especially leaves room for emptiness and silence.
